P.R. Thakur Government College, Thakurnagar, was set to celebrate “Observation of Students’ Week, 2026” from 2nd to 8th January 2026, as per Government directive dated 10th December 2025. The week-long event featured a series of activities including an Inaugural Session and Campus Cleaning, a Scholarship Awareness Programme, a Parent-Teacher Meeting, a Medical Camp in collaboration with Chandpara Rural Hospital, Annual Athletic Meet, a Higher Education Orientation Programme for school learners, and a grand Cultural Programme with a Concluding Ceremony. Various college committees including NSS, the Cultural Committee, and the Games & Sports Committee were responsible for conducting their respective events.

A Campus Cleaning Drive was successfully organized by the National Service Scheme (NSS) of P.R. Thakur Government College, Thakurnagar, on 2nd January 2026 as part of the weeklong Observation of Students’ Week, 2026. The drive commenced at 11:00 a.m. alongside the Inaugural Session and witnessed enthusiastic participation from students and staff members alike. Volunteers actively cleaned various parts of the campus, including corridors, and the college premises, ensuring a neat and hygienic environment. The drive successfully instilled a sense of cleanliness, discipline, and environmental responsibility among the student community. The event was appreciated by the college administration, and it set a positive and energetic tone for the remaining activities of the Students’ Observation Week 2026.

A Student Credit Card Scheme and Scholarship Awareness Programme was successfully conducted on 3rd January 2026, 11:00 a.m. onwards at P.R. Thakur Government College, Thakurnagar, as part of the Observation of Students’ Week, 2026. The programme was organized by the Career Counselling and Placement Cell & Students’ Welfare Committee. The session aimed at educating students about the benefits of the West Bengal Student Credit Card Scheme and various scholarship opportunities available to them. Students were briefed on the eligibility criteria, application process, and financial benefits under these schemes, helping them make informed decisions regarding their higher education and financial planning. The programme was well-received by the student community and proved to be highly informative and beneficial, empowering students with the knowledge needed to avail themselves of these Government initiatives.

A Parent-Teacher Meeting was successfully held on 3rd January, 2026, 1:00 p.m. onwards at P.R. Thakur Government College, Thakurnagar, as part of the Observation of Students’ Week, 2026. The meeting was organized by the Faculty Members of the Respective Departments and witnessed a good turnout of parents and guardians. The meeting provided a valuable platform for parents and teachers to interact openly and discuss the academic progress, attendance, and overall performance of students. Faculty members apprised parents about the curriculum, examination patterns, and co-curricular activities of the college. Parents also shared their feedback and concerns regarding their ward’s development, which was attentively heard and addressed by the teachers. The meeting proved to be a productive and meaningful exchange, strengthening the bond between the institution and the families of students, and reaffirming the college’s commitment to the holistic growth and well-being of every student.

A Medical Camp was successfully organized on 5th January 2026, 11:00 a.m. onwards at P.R. Thakur Government College, Thakurnagar, as part of the Observation of Students’ Week, 2026. The camp was conducted jointly by the National Service Scheme (NSS) and the Student’s Health-Hygiene Advisory Sub Committee in collaboration with Chandpara Rural Hospital. Experienced doctors and medical staff from Chandpara Rural Hospital were present on campus and provided free health check-ups to students, teaching, and non-teaching staff members. The camp covered general health screenings, blood pressure monitoring, blood sugar testing, and basic medical consultations. Students were also educated on the importance of maintaining personal hygiene, a balanced diet, and a healthy lifestyle. The medical camp was widely appreciated by the college community and proved to be an extremely beneficial initiative, reflecting the college’s deep commitment to the health and well-being of its students and staff members.
